Elliptical exercise equipment with stowable arms
First Claim
1. An exercise device, comprising:
- a frame;
a foot link having a rearward portion that is constrained to move in an orbital path and a forward portion;
a swing arm having a pivotal connection to the frame, the swing arm including a hand gripping portion;
an engagement mechanism having a first portion coupled to the swing arm and a second portion coupled to the foot link; and
an arm enabling/disabling mechanism operatively engaged with the swing arm, the arm enabling/disabling mechanism including an enabled position in which the swing arm is coupled to the foot link by the enabling/disabling mechanism such that the swing arm is fixed with respect to the foot link so that a force applied to the swing arm will produce a corresponding force on the forward portion of the foot link, and the arm enabling/disabling mechanism including a disabled position in which at least a portion of the swing arm is disengaged from the foot link and fixed with respect to the frame, the enabling/disabling mechanism comprising;
a latching member rotatable between (1) an engaged state in which the latching member latches the swing arm to either the foot link for the enabled position or the frame for the disabled position and (2) a disengaged state in which the swing arm is not fixed with respect to either the foot link or the frame;
a bias member applying a torque to the latching member to bias the latching member towards the engaged state; and
a manual actuator configured to rotate the latching member against biasing of the bias member from the engaged state to the disengaged state in response to being manipulated by a user'"'"'s hand while the user'"'"'s hand remains in contact with the hand gripping portion;
wherein the latching member comprises a latching plate defining an enable slot and disable slot, and the exercise device further including an enable pin and a disable pin, such that when the enable pin is secured in the enable slot the swing arm is enabled and when the disable pin is secured in the disable slot the swing arm is disabled; and
wherein the enable slot and the disable slot face both face in a same direction about a rotational axis of the latching plate, either a clockwise direction or a counter-clockwise direction.

Abstract
An exercise device includes a frame defining a longitudinal axis. A foot link includes a rearward portion that is constrained to move in an orbital path approximately parallel to the longitudinal axis and a forward portion that reciprocally engages the guide track. A swing arm is a pivotally connected to the frame, the swing arm having an upper portion extending above the pivotal connection and a lower portion disposed below the pivotal connection. An engagement mechanism having a first portion coupled to the lower portion and a second portion coupled to the forward portion of the foot link, such that a rearward force applied to the upper portion will produce a force on the forward portion having a downward component. An arm enabling/disabling mechanism is positioned on the elongate swing arm below the pivotal connection. The arm enabling/disabling mechanism can be effectuated by a user without the user interrupting exercise.

12. An arm enabling/disabling mechanism for use with an elliptical exercise device having an arm mechanism, comprising:
-
a latching mechanism alternatively engaging and disengaging the arm mechanism; and an actuator contained proximate to a user using the exercise equipment, the actuator controlling the latching mechanism;
whereby the arm enabling/disabling mechanism can be effectuated by a user without the user interrupting exercise, wherein the elliptical exercise device includes a foot link and the latching mechanism in an engaged position couples the arm mechanism to the foot link and wherein in a disengaged position the arm mechanism is not coupled to the foot link and wherein a latching plate of the latching mechanism is biased around a pivot point in opposition to the actuator, thereby providing biasing resistance to the actuator, wherein the latching mechanism includes;
an enable pin extending from the arm enabling mechanism;
a disable pin extending from the exercise device; and
a latching plate including a first slot and a second slot facing in a same direction about a rotational axis of the latching plate, either a clockwise direction or a counter-clockwise direction, wherein the first slot and the second slot receive the enable pin and the disable pin to selectively enable movement of the arm mechanism and disable movement of the arm mechanism, respectively. - View Dependent Claims (13, 14, 15, 16, 17, 18, 19, 20)
